Ham and Cheese "Sushi" Rolls

YIELD Makes 8 (8-piece) servings

INGREDIENTS

4 thin slices deli ham (about 4X4 inches) 1 package (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ened 1 piece (4 inches long) seedless cucumber, quartered lengthwise (about 1/2 cucumber) 4 thin slices (about 4X4 inches) American or Cheddar cheese, at room temperature 1 red bell pepper, cut into thin 4-inch-long strips

PREPARATION:

  1. For ham sushi, pat 1 ham slice with paper towel to remove excess moisture. Spread 2 tablespoons cream cheese to edges of ham slice. Pat 1 cucumber piece with paper towel to remove excess moisture; place at edge of ham slice. Roll up tightly, pressing gently to seal. Wrap in plastic wrap; refrigerate. Repeat with remaining ham slices, cream cheese and cucumber pieces.
  2. For cheese sushi, spread 2 tablespoons cream cheese to edges of 1 cheese slice. Place 2 red pepper strips at edge of cheese slice. Roll up tightly, pressing gently to seal. Wrap in plastic wrap; refrigerate. Repeat with remaining cheese slices, cream cheese and red pepper strips.
  3. To serve, remove plastic wrap from ham and cheese rolls. Cut each roll into 8 (1/2-inch-wide) pieces.
